How Direct Listings Are Replacing Traditional IPOs for Founders

from The Startup Exit Podcast with Fexingo: IPOs, Acquisitions, and Founder Liquidity Events · host Fexingo

Lucas and Luna break down why more founders are choosing direct listings over traditional IPOs, using the recent high-profile example of a company that saved tens of millions in underwriting fees. They explore the mechanics, the liquidity benefits for early investors, and the risks—including the lack of a price stabilization backstop. With the S&P 500 down over the past week and volatility creeping up, they discuss whether direct listings hold up in choppy markets. Plus, they compare the direct listing path to the traditional IPO route using real numbers from recent deals, and touch on how the SEC's evolving stance is shaping founder decisions.
